MySQL 中的 XSLT_PROCESSOR() 函数:XML 转换的利器 大家好!今天我们来深入探讨 MySQL 中的一个鲜为人知但功能强大的函数:XSLT_PROCESSOR()。这个函数允许我们在 MySQL 数据库内部直接使用 XSLT (Extensible Stylesheet Language Transformations) 处理器来转换 XML 数据。虽然它不如其他一些常见的 MySQL 函数那么普及,但在处理需要在数据库层面进行 XML 数据转换的场景中,XSLT_PROCESSOR() 可以发挥关键作用。 1. 什么是 XSLT? 在深入 XSLT_PROCESSOR() 之前,我们需要先了解 XSLT 的基本概念。XSLT 是一种用于将 XML 文档转换为其他格式(例如 HTML, text, 或其他 XML 文档)的语言。它基于 XML 本身,使用 XPath 表达式来选择 XML 文档中的特定节点,并使用模板规则来定义如何转换这些节点。 XSLT 的核心思想是: XML 文档 (Source XML): 需要被转换的原始 XML 数据。 XSLT 样式表 …